Comprehending Psychiatry and the Role of Psychiatrists
Psychiatrists are skilled medical physicians who concentrate on mental health. They are certified to diagnose and treat a wide variety of mental health conditions, from stress and [Acute Anxiety Treatment](https://www.janeroa.top/health/treating-anxiety-a-comprehensive-guide/) and depression to schizophrenia and bipolar disorder. Their training allows them to combine their understanding of both the physical and mental elements of wellness.

Private psychiatry refers to mental health services used outside of a public or government-funded health care system. In this context, clients can engage with psychiatrists privately, often through direct payment for services rather than counting on openly funded programs.
Functions of Private PsychiatryDirect Access: Patients can often protect visits more rapidly than through public systems.Personalized Care: Private psychiatrists might provide more personalized and flexible treatment alternatives.Privacy: Privacy and confidentiality might be enhanced in private settings.Advantages of Seeing a Psychiatrist Privately
A number of benefits featured going with private psychiatric care, including:
Reduced Waiting Times: One of the most significant benefits of private services is that people typically experience much shorter wait times to see a psychiatrist.Custom-made Treatment Plans: Private professionals might use customized treatment methods that align with a person's needs and circumstances.Greater accessibility of experts: Patients can access a wide variety of experts who might have niche competence.Versatile Scheduling: Private psychiatrists regularly provide appointments outside of traditional office hours, making it easier for individuals to fit them into busy schedules.Boosted Comfort: Many individuals find private settings more comfortable and less intimidating than public clinics or healthcare facilities.Disadvantages of Seeing a Psychiatrist Privately
While private psychiatry has its advantages, it likewise includes downsides. Key downsides to consider consist of:
Cost: Private psychiatric care can be costly and may not be covered by insurance.Lack of Collaboration: There may be less chances for cooperation with other doctor within a public system.Quality Variability: The quality of care may differ significantly in between professionals, as there is less policy in private sectors.Potentially Less Comprehensive: Private practices might provide minimal services compared to multidisciplinary teams readily available in public settings.How to Find a Private Psychiatrist
Finding an ideal private psychiatrist involves a number of actions. Here is a list of considerations:
Research Credentials: Ensure that the psychiatrist is certified and holds the essential licenses.Check Specializations: Look for psychiatrists who specialize in the specific issues you are dealing with.Referrals and Reviews: Ask for suggestions from main care doctors or inspect online reviews from previous patients.Insurance coverage Compatibility: Verify whether the psychiatrist accepts your insurance coverage (if appropriate).Initial Consultations: Many psychiatrists provide a preliminary assessment. 1. How much does a private psychiatrist cost?The cost of seeing a private psychiatrist can differ widely depending on place, experience, and services provided. On average, sessions can vary from ₤ 150 to ₤ 500 or more. 2. Can I get compensated by my insurance for seeing a private psychiatrist?Some insurance coverage prepares deal reimbursement for services rendered by private psychiatrists
, but it often depends upon whether the psychiatrist is in-network. It's suggested to contact your insurance provider for particular information. 3. Is private psychiatric care effective?Research recommends that the efficiency of private psychiatric care can be similar to that of public
services, provided the psychiatrist is skilled and utilizes suitable treatment methods. 4. Can I talk to a psychiatrist online?Yes, numerous private psychiatrists provide telehealth services, enabling patients to participate in appointments remotely through safe video conferencing.

5. What need to I expect throughout my very first appointment?During the first appointment
, a psychiatrist typically carries out an extensive assessment to comprehend your mental health history and current issues.

Discussions might include symptoms, treatment objectives, and possible treatment plans.
